Park Gang-su, Mayor of Mapo-gu, Attends Jandari Festival, a Major Village Event in Hongdae View original image

Park Gang-su, Mayor of Mapo District, attended the ‘Jandari Festival in Red Road’ held at Hongdae Red Road on the afternoon of the 15th.


The Jandari Festival, which has been ongoing since 2015, is a representative village festival where residents, merchants, and cultural artists of Seogyo-dong gather. It was temporarily suspended due to COVID-19 but resumed this year.


Hosted and organized by the Jandari Festival Planning Team, this festival was led by comedian Na Kyung-hoon and featured performances in the following order: ▲‘Black Eagles’ cheerleading ▲foreign K-POP dance team KCDS performance ▲children’s cheerleading ▲Mr. Trot’s Yoon Jun-hyup performance ▲salsa dance performance.


At the end of the performances, a dance festival combining the dazzling vocals of DJ Yang Hye-seung and EDM was prepared, bringing fun and emotion to the audience.



Mayor Park Gang-su said, “I hope the Jandari Festival will be an occasion for uniting local residents in harmony, restoring the disappearing sense of community, and solidifying the activation of cultural arts at Hongdae Red Road.”
